Lazard 401(k) Plan

The Lazard Freres & Co. LLC Employees' Savings Plan is a single-employer defined contribution 401(k) plan covering eligible employees of Lazard Freres & Co. LLC and adopting affiliates. As of December 31, 2024, the plan held about 832 million dollars in net assets available for benefits, including roughly 828.6 million dollars in participant-directed investments. Fidelity Management Trust Company serves as trustee and recordkeeper for the plan. The investment menu includes mutual funds, common/collective trusts, and a self-directed brokerage account feature.

Fund lineup

Fund Asset Class Type
TCW MetWest Total Return Bond Fund Plan Class US Bonds Active
Vanguard Federal Money Market Fund Money Market Other
Vanguard Extended Market Index Fund Class Institutional US Mid Cap Index
Vanguard Institutional Index Fund Institutional Plus US Large Cap Index
Vanguard Total International Stock Index Fund Class Institutional International Equity Index
Harbor Capital Appreciation CIT Class R US Large Cap Active
Lazard International Equity CIT Class LZ International Equity Active
Lazard Emerging Markets CIT Class LZ Emerging Markets Active
Lazard US Small Mid-Cap Equity CIT Class LZ US Small Cap Active
Lazard US Equity Concentrated CIT LZ US Large Cap Active
Vanguard Target Retirement 2020 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ement 2025 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ement 2030 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ement 2035 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ement 2040 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ement 2045 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ement 2050 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ement 2055 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ement 2060 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ement 2065 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ement 2070 Trust II Target-date Index
Vanguard Target Retirement Income Trust II Target-date Index
IDF (Individually Directed Fund - self-directed brokerage account) Other Other

Employer match

Match summary
100% match on the first 4% of eligible pay
Match cap 100% of pay
Effective match rate 4%
Vesting Participant contributions are immediately vested; Company matching contributions vest 100% after three years of credited service (cliff).
Waiting period Not disclosed in the 2024 filing
